With a stay at Courtyard by Marriott Gatlinburg Downtown in Gatlinburg, you'll be in a national park, a 3-minute walk from Gatlinburg Convention Center and 13 minutes by foot from Great Smoky Mountains National Park. This hotel is 0.3 mi (0.5 km) from Gatlinburg SkyPark and 0.7 mi (1.1 km) from Ripley's Aquarium of the Smokies.

Yes, on-site parking is available for a fee of approximately USD 16.46 per night.
Breakfast is available at The Bistro, with options for to-go meals priced between USD 6 to 20 per person. Specific serving hours are not mentioned.
Check-in is at 4:00 PM and check-out is at 11:00 AM. Early or late check-in/check-out may be available upon request, but additional charges may apply.
The property offers accessible features including elevators, step-free entrances, and wheelchair-accessible facilities in public areas and rooms.
The hotel is located within walking distance of downtown Gatlinburg, approximately 0.3 miles from the Gatlinburg Convention Center and about 1 mile from the Great Smoky Mountains National Park.
Yes, there is a heated indoor pool available for guests. Specific operational hours are not mentioned.
